Cafe Brainwaves explores how developmental processes, educational practice and wider systems shape children and young people’s journeys into adulthood. It focuses on coherence: how skills, identity, opportunities and support structures align over time to influence meaningful adult outcomes.

The journeys into meaningful adulthood can be understood through three interacting domains.


Development

Neurodiversity, cognitive development, executive functioning, emotional regulation, identity formation

Practice

Curriculum design, scaffolding, skill acquisition and generalisation, prompt fading, and supported transition planning

Systems

Inspection frameworks, organisational policy, transition pathways, funding structures, support withdrawal frameworks, and statutory thresholds


By exploring these interactions, Café Brainwaves seeks to better understand the conditions that enable young people to move into adulthood with stability, agency, and meaningful future pathways.
